## Badge System Migration — Contractor Access

The Delmar Building is migrating from SwipeLine to the new KeyArc readers. Old contractor badges stop working Friday. New badges issued at the Level 1 kiosk, weekdays 08:00–12:00 only. Bring photo ID and your work order number. Until your KeyArc badge is active, use the contractor entrance on Dray Street with the code below.

turnstile pass: bdg-TXR-4

## Runbook: Deploying Quotagate (per-tenant rate quotas)

Welcome aboard. Quotagate enforces per-tenant request quotas for the Marrowfield platform, so a bad deploy can throttle paying tenants instantly. Always deploy to the shadow tier first and watch the quota-decision mismatch graph for fifteen minutes; anything above 0.5% means roll back. Quota config changes and binary releases ship together and must be signed as one artifact — partial deploys are the top incident cause. Signing happens on the release host using the deploy key shown below.

deploy key for kajof-fajop: bky6_gDHw9Q

## Canary gating for Driftgate releases

Future maintainers: the canary stage promotes only when all three gates pass — error rate below 0.5% over 30 minutes, p99 latency within 10% of baseline, and zero failed health probes across both regions. Do not override gates manually without a second reviewer; the audit job flags unsigned overrides and halts promotion. Any promotion artifact must be signed before the gate controller will accept it. The signing key used by the promotion pipeline appears immediately below.

signing key of bagap-yawep = bky13_TbfT6ZMUoGJo2

## Changelog — Font vendoring defaults changed

As of this release, the Bracken UI build no longer fetches third-party fonts at build time. All typefaces used by the Lanternwell suite are now vendored into the repo under a dedicated assets directory, and the fetch step is skipped by default. If you're onboarding, nothing to install — the fonts travel with the checkout. The build flags controlling this behavior are listed below.

settings of hadup-yafog:
LAMAEL_PIN=3761
LAMAEL_TENANT=istmir
LAMAEL_METRICS_HOST=metrics.lamael.plorvasys.test
LAMAEL_SEAL=seal_8ea68500
LAMAEL_STANDBY_TEAM=fraok